At Care UK's Montfort Manor in Ashford, Kent, providing the highest standard of care for residents is at the heart of what we do. As part of our friendly team, you'll have the opportunity to develop your career and the support to go far.
Our team works in a purpose-built care home with a family atmosphere. We provide specialist dementia care and expert nursing dementia care with fantastic facilities for residents, including a cinema, cafe and hair salon, as well as beautiful landscaped gardens.

Join our team and you'll have the chance to get creative in the kitchen while cooking up nutritious, well-balanced meals that have a direct impact on residents’ health and wellbeing.
Many catering colleagues join us from restaurants or hotels where they’re used to working long hours late into the night. In a care home, you’ll work more sociable hours, and you’ll also have the opportunity to build relationships by getting to know residents and their tastes and preferences. This is a role where you can really make a difference.
